Chapter 10

Jenna's POV

"Jenna. Jenna, open your eyes. Jenna!" I heard a panic-stricken voice as my cheek was constantly patted to wake me up.

"Jenna, our son is crying. He's hungry. If not for me, wake up for him. Please." I heard the desperate plea before I slowly opened my eyes.

"Jenna!" I was still disoriented when someone pulled me up and hugged the dear life out of me. "Fuck, goodness! You're fine. I thought... I thought you won't wake up."

I blinked my eyes and looked around desperately, "Where is my son?"

"Our son is with Oakley. He was hungry and I wanted him checked for injuries. He's taken him to the hotel to Martha, the woman who delivered him. She'll take care of him." My chest became light as I sat there with my face against his chest. 

"I thought you'd kick his àss, Jenna. Why did you let him assault you?" Jace's fingers grabbed my jaw to make me look into his gray eyes. 

"I got scared." My voice wavered and he hugged me again. 

"Fúck! This is why I asked you to let me come. Did he do anything else other than... This." He pulled me back to run a hand over my cheek. 

Tingles ran over my skin. I gulped and nodded in no. 

"Good, because if he had, I would've brought a fucking blood storm for him."

"That's not needed. I'll do it myself."

"Will you? I don't think you will ever be able to do it! You just freaked out in there. I'm so disappointed in you." 

"I was scared, damn it!" I clutched his collars and screamed in his face. "They were talking about hurting my son. That froze me and I couldn't do anything.... Come to think of it, it's better this way. Some people inside saw what happened to me, but they agreed that I was a loyal Luna. They respect me and when I bring Chris' lies to the front, they'll realize their mistakes."

"You women are so dramatic!" He huffed and tightened his hold on my face. "You beat around the bush before you seek your revenge. We men are better in this case. Just do a fist fight, kill the other person and it's done."

"That won't be as painful."

I stayed there in his arms, although I kept wondering why. Alpha King Jace and I just met yesterday, and today I was seeking solace in his arms. Suddenly my stomach squeezed and I hissed. 

"What's wrong?"

"I think I should rest. My stomach is aching."

"That's what you should've done since the start and let me handle that bastard." He sneered. 

"Take me to my son."

"Our son, you mean." My eyebrows jumped when he picked me in his arms. 

"I... I can walk, Alpha King Jace."

"I know, but my son's mother deserves special treatment. After all, she gave birth to the Kingston kingdom's prince." My eyes lowered to his throat as my cheeks heated up. 

His words were doing weird things now. Maybe it was more noticeable now that I am not bound by a mate bond. 

Come to think of it, there's another problem at hand— marriage with the alpha king... Do I really want it? 

****

Two months later, 

"What do you need, Jared? Why are you throwing a fit of tantrum today?" I sighed for the umpteenth time as I tried to rock my son in my hands. 

He has been crying for the last two hours. I don't know what he wants. I've tried feeding him and checked his diaper. Where we are staying currently is a bit warm here, thus I also took him out to enjoy the winds. Nothing is working, though. 

"Jared, you're so small. How am I going to understand what you need!" My forehead creased as I rocked him harder. 

"What's wrong!" The door swung open and Jace walked in. 

"Jace, thank goodness, you came. Jared is crying and I don't understand why."

He walked over to us and took our son from me. The second he went to his arms, he stopped and calmed down. A minute later, he grinned like he was seeing an angel.

"Aww, my baby missed me." Jace's joy knew no bounds whereas I scoffed.

"What a selfish little brat. I spend sleepless nights and change his diapers, but he cries to be with you. So ungrateful." I humphed and looked away.

"Hey, that doesn't mean he doesn't love you. He just loves me a little more."

"Whatever helps you sleep better at night." I trudged over to the window to look out.

After leaving Chris' pack, Jace and I didn't go to his kingdom. He brought us to one of his private properties in the kingdom, which is Sandalwood forest. A lovely cottage was built in the middle of it and there was all the comfort a woman in her postpartum period would need. 

Jace said he wanted me to sort my emotions out and think about us before we go to his kingdom. I've been here since then while he travelled back and forth because his duties can't stop for us. He's been gone for a few days and our son— whom we decided to name Jared— has been whining until recently.

"Look Mamma, what daddy brought for you from his kingdom." Jace appeared behind me.

"What did he bring?" My mouth fell open as he was holding a pretty velvet box holding a platinum bracelet. The initial of my name (or say his name, or maybe our son's name: J) was carved in the middle and it shone like a rainbow when it caught the sun rays.

"This is beautiful." I whispered and took it from him.

"I haven't given you anything for giving Jared to me. This is a small gift from me to you. Thanks, Jenna." I lifted my eyes and my breathing got caught.

Jace's eyes were clouded with desires. The air around us crackled with tension— sexual tension, making my nerves twist and turn.

"J-jace, t-thanks for this. This is really pretty." I was about to put it on when, "Wait, let me do it. Hold our son for a sec."

I sucked in a breath before taking Jared in my arms. 

Jace and I... We have been discussing Jared's future very seriously. He's an amazing father. No matter how occupied he is, he always makes time to spend with our son. He's there for me too. Every Sunday, he takes a day off and helps me take care of Jared. 

That means Sunday is my day off too. Jace does everything except for feeding. He brings him to me when our son is hungry. 

The last two months were pretty clean and surprising. I learned things about my baby's father that can make any woman fall for him. Most of all, he's very understanding. He never asked me about Chris or our past. He never tells me what I have to do or don't. I like that a lot about him. 

But still, he hasn't proposed to me officially for a marriage although he keeps giving me hints. 

My skin burned when his fingers danced along my wrist. He was putting on the bracelet with leisure, enjoying how my skin felt against his fingers. I just looked at him as his eyes lingered on my wrist. He seemed to be lost in thought. 

"Marry me, Jenna." My heart trembled when he whispered.

"J-jace, I—" 

His eyes came up and my breathing faltered, "We have a son and... Err, we both want to give him a good life. It won't be good if we live separately so..." 

Disappointment made me clench my jaw— he could've done better.

I'm not an idiot. I know he likes me. His desires are written all over his face but he's asking me to marry him for our son. 

"Is that all?" I raised an eye. 

"Yeah." He smiled nervously and I scoffed. 

"Fine." I pulled my hand and walked out of the room. 

"Jenna, you didn't answer me. What's your decision? Will you stay?" He followed after me. 

My stomach was dancing at the fact that he was following me around. I descended the stairs and came down to the living room. But what now? I had no idea what to do. 

"Jenna," He gripped my wrist and spun me. "You didn't answer." 

"What's there to answer?" My words made his adam's apple jump. "Jared is my son. I'll be there for him so... Yeah." 

"Yeah? Is that all?" His face contorted in disappointment as if he wanted a better answer. 

"Yeah, our son needs me. I'll stay for him." I said and freed my hand from him. "I'll... I'll go out to the garden, okay. You freshen up and rest."

When I turned and exited the cottage, the hair on my back stood on end. I could imagine the Alpha King burning holes in my back with his searing gray eyes. Biting back a smile, I came out. 

'You know the man wanted you to say that you'll stay for him too.' Gianna laughed. 

'That's if he showed he wants me as more than his son's mother.' 

'Oh, Jenna, you're going to make him go wild. You do know he wants you.'

'I do. But he's not brave enough to say that, is he?' Instinctively my head swirled and my eyes landed on the cottage. 

A shirtless Jace was standing at the window of our room— His eyes pinning me with an accusatory glare. Then he muttered something and went inside. 

My heart was banging in my chest. The last month we spent together, a lot of things have changed. Jace is nothing like I thought he was. He might have been a playboy before meeting me. With me, he's a complete family man. 

The sparks have been flying between us for a long time. But he hasn't yet tried to take the first step. 

'Maybe he's nervous.' Gianna guessed. 

'Nervous... And him? Nice joke. He's been with more women than I've had contractions that night I gave birth to Jared. He's just resisting accepting his feelings.'

'Well then, be prepared for the consequences. Because he's getting into that desperate predator mode.' Gianna said as I looked back at the cottage. 

Jace was back on the window, glaring at me while his eyes roamed all over my body. 

Tbc...
